Foros del Web » Programando para Internet » ASPX (.net) »

Verificar la validez de un archivo xml generado desde un control treeview

Estas en el tema de Verificar la validez de un archivo xml generado desde un control treeview en el foro de ASPX (.net) en Foros del Web. Hola a todos!! Tengo un control web treeview que lo enlazo a una bd sql server, mediante el cual hago la conexion a la base ...
  #1 (permalink)  
Antiguo 23/07/2006, 18:35
 
Fecha de Ingreso: octubre-2005
Mensajes: 180
Antigüedad: 18 años, 6 meses
Puntos: 0
Verificar la validez de un archivo xml generado desde un control treeview

Hola a todos!!
Tengo un control web treeview que lo enlazo a una bd sql server, mediante el cual hago la conexion a la base de datos, y jala muy bien, pero el detalle es que se alenta un poko por ke son muchos nodos, entonces al ver el html que genera cuando ya esta la pagina en el explorador de IE veo que me genera un xml, y se me vino a la idea de llenar el arbol mediante este xml generado por el mismo control, pero resulta que no me lo toma como valido al correrlo desde el .net

Aqui les pongo el xml generado por el control, para que me digan si no es un xml valido :



Código:
<?XML:NAMESPACE PREFIX=TVNS />
<?IMPORT NAMESPACE=TVNS IMPLEMENTATION="/webctrl_client/1_0/treeview.htc" />
<tvns:treeview id="TreeView1" defaultStyle="color:SteelBlue;font-family:verdana;font-size:7pt;" imageUrl="http://192.100.1.170/webctrl_client/1_0/images/folder.gif" selectedImageUrl="http://192.100.1.170/webctrl_client/1_0/images/folderopen.gif" expandedImageUrl="http://192.100.1.170/webctrl_client/1_0/images/folder.gif" target="doc" selectedNodeIndex="0" HelperID="__TreeView1_State__" systemImagesPath="http://192.100.1.170/webctrl_client/1_0/treeimages/" showPlus="false" selectExpands="true" onexpand="javascript: if (this.clickedNodeIndex != null) this.queueEvent('onexpand', this.clickedNodeIndex)" oncollapse="javascript: if (this.clickedNodeIndex != null) this.queueEvent('oncollapse', this.clickedNodeIndex)" oncheck="javascript: if (this.clickedNodeIndex != null) this.queueEvent('oncheck', this.clickedNodeIndex)" onselectedindexchange="javascript: if (event.oldTreeNodeIndex != event.newTreeNodeIndex) this.queueEvent('onselectedindexchange', event.oldTreeNodeIndex + ',' + event.newTreeNodeIndex)" style="background-color:AliceBlue;font-family:verdana;height:475px;width:250px;Z-INDEX: 102; LEFT: 0px; POSITION: absolute; TOP: 0px">
	<tvns:treenode Selected="true" NavigateUrl="http://192.100.1.170/iewebcontrols/info.aspx?id=1">
		Fiscal Federal<tvns:treenode NavigateUrl="http://192.100.1.170/iewebcontrols/info.aspx?id=1&amp;idt=2">
			Legislación Fiscal Derogadas<tvns:treenode NavigateUrl="http://192.100.1.170/iewebcontrols/info.aspx?id=1&amp;idt=2&amp;idl=1048">
				Ley del Impuesto Sobre la Renta<tvns:treenode NavigateUrl="http://192.100.1.170/iewebcontrols/info.aspx?id=1&amp;idt=2&amp;idl=1624" Target="doc">
					TÍTULO I. DISPOSICIONES GENERALES<tvns:treenode NavigateUrl="http://192.100.1.170/iewebcontrols/info.aspx?id=1&amp;idt=2&amp;idl=1643" Target="doc">
						Art. 1o. Sujetos del impuesto
					</tvns:treenode><tvns:treenode NavigateUrl="http://192.100.1.170/iewebcontrols/info.aspx?id=1&amp;idt=2&amp;idl=1647" Target="doc">
						Art. 2o. Concepto de establecimiento permanente
					</tvns:treenode><tvns:treenode NavigateUrl="http://192.100.1.170/iewebcontrols/info.aspx?id=1&amp;idt=2&amp;idl=1648" Target="doc">

       ..............
       ..............
       Ya no les pongo todos los nodos por ke son mas de 10,000

       Entonces nos vamos hasta el final 


</tvns:treenode><tvns:treenode NavigateUrl="http://192.100.1.170/iewebcontrols/info.aspx?id=14&amp;idt=1&amp;idl=4677">
				Julio<tvns:treenode NavigateUrl="http://192.100.1.170/iewebcontrols/info.aspx?id=14&amp;idt=1&amp;idl=4679" Target="doc">
					Primera Resolución -  De Modificaciones a la Resolución Miscelánea Fiscal para 2006.
				</tvns:treenode><tvns:treenode NavigateUrl="http://192.100.1.170/iewebcontrols/info.aspx?id=14&amp;idt=1&amp;idl=4682" Target="doc">
					Acuerdo -  Acuerdo que determina las Reglas para la aplicación
				</tvns:treenode>
			</tvns:treenode>
		</tvns:treenode>
	</tvns:treenode><tvns:treenode NavigateUrl="http://192.100.1.170/iewebcontrols/info.aspx?id=12">
		Ayuda?<tvns:treenode NavigateUrl="http://192.100.1.170/iewebcontrols/info.aspx?id=12&amp;idt=1">
			Indice de Colores
		</tvns:treenode>
	</tvns:treenode>
</tvns:treeview>
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 12:37.